Popular places to visit

Basilica de Nuestra Senora del Pilar
Experience the rich Baroque beauty of this ornate basilica, built on the site where devotees believe that the Virgin Mary appeared on a marble pillar in A.D. 40.

Plaza del Pilar
Home to many of Zaragoza’s most important sights, this square is also a popular gathering place and the setting for the city’s biggest annual festivals.

Grande José Antonio Labordeta Park
Discover a picturesque urban oasis of lawns, trees, flowers, gardens and monuments. Stroll, jog or cycle through its surroundings, play sports or simply relax.

Plaza de Espana
Head to the center of Zaragoza for its main square, a large space of historical importance that is near many other major attractions.

Aljaferia Palace
Enjoy your time in Zaragoza with a visit to a magnificent palace that served for centuries as a royal residence.
